■ ■■■IIIIIIIMI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IMI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IKI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III Charles Semple Pettis Professor of Physics B.S., University ot Wisconsin, 1917; M.S., Uni- versity of Wisconsin, 1918; Researcli Fellow- ship, University of Wisconsin, 1817-1918; Grad- uate Work, University of Wisconsin and Har- vard University. Professor of Chemistry and Physics, Davis and Elkins College, 1920-1922; Assistant Professor of Physics, Wofford College, 1922-1928; Profes- sor ot Physics, Wofford College, since 1928. William Raymond Bourne Assistant Professor of Modern Languages A.B., Wofford College, 1923. Professor of English, Davenport College, 1923- 1925; Assistant Professor of Modern Languages, Wofford College, since 1925. Kenneth Daniel Coates Assistant Professor of English A.B., University ot North Carolina, 1925; Sum- mer School, University of North Carolina, 1928. Teacher of English and Science, Smithfi ld High School, North Carolina, 1925-1927. Carl Lafayette Epting, Jr. Assistant Professor of History and Economics A.B., Newberry College; A.M., University of South Carolina; Graduate Work, University of North Carolina. 24

Clarence Clifford Norton Professor of Social Science B.S., Millsaps College, 1919; A.M., Emory Uni- versity, 1920; Graduate Worlc. Columbia Uni- versity, 1922; Graduate Worli, University of North Carolina, 1923-2,5; Ph.D., University of North Carolina, 1927. Professor of History, Alexander College, 1920- 1923; Dean, Alexander College, 1921-1923; Teaching Fellow in History and Government, University of North Carolina, 1923-1924; In- structor in History and Government, University of North Carolina, 1924-192,5; Acting Professor of Social Science, Wofford Colleg since 1925; Professor of American Government. Wake For- est College, summer 1927. John West Harris B K Assistant Professor of English A.B. and A.M., Wofford, 1916; Ph.D., Univer- sity of North Carolina, 1928; one year law, Columbia Ilniversity, 1919-1920; Summer School, 1921-1922, Columbia University. Professor of English, Darlington School for Boys, Rome, Ga., 191B-1917; Instructor in Fly- ing in United States Air Service, 1917-1918; As- sistant Professor of English, Wofford College, 1921-1925; Assistant Professor of English, Uni- versity of North Carolina, 1925-1928. John Leonard Salmon Assistant Professor of French A.B., Center College, 1914; Chicago University, Summer of 1916; Columbia University, Summer of 1922; Harvard University, 1925-1928; A.M., Harvard University, 1926. Instructor of Modern Languages, Millersburg Military Institute, 1915-1918; Tennessee Military Institute, 1918-1919; Castle Heights Military Academy, 1919-1921; Assistant Professor of Modern Languages, Wofford College, 1921-1925; Austin Fellow in Romance Languages, Harvard University, 1926-1927; Instructor in French, Harvard University, 1927-1928; Wofford College, since 1928. Raymond Agnew Patterson Assistant Professor of Chemistry and Modern Languages A.B., Wofford, 1916; A.M., Wofford, 1917. Assistant Professor of Chemistry and Modern Lahg-uages, Wofford College, since 1926.
